protected void Page_Load(object sender, EventArgs e) { this.Page.Title = "增加试题"; if (!IsPostBack) { if (Session["userID"] == null) { Response.Redirect("Login.aspx"); } else { string userId = Session["userID"].ToString(); string userName = UserManager.GetUserName(userId); Label i1 = (Label)Page.Master.FindControl("labUser"); i1.Text = userName; //展示绑定的数据并将它展示在下拉列表中 ddlCourse.Items.Clear(); Course course = new Course(); List <Course> list = SingleSelectedService.ListCourse(); for (int i = 0; i < list.Count; i++) { ListItem item = new ListItem(list[i].DepartmentName.ToString(), list[i].DepartmentId.ToString()); ddlCourse.Items.Add(item); } } } }
protected void Page_Load(object sender, EventArgs e) { this.Page.Title = "修改试题"; //展示绑定的数据并将它展示在下拉列表中 if (!IsPostBack) { if (Session["userID"] == null) { Response.Redirect("Login.aspx"); } else { string userId = Session["userID"].ToString(); string userName = UserManager.GetUserName(userId); Label i1 = (Label)Page.Master.FindControl("labUser"); i1.Text = userName; ddlCourse.Items.Clear(); Course course = new Course(); List <Course> list = SingleSelectedService.ListCourse(); for (int i = 0; i < list.Count; i++) { ListItem item = new ListItem(list[i].DepartmentName.ToString(), list[i].DepartmentId.ToString()); ddlCourse.Items.Add(item); } //根据ID展示相应的值 int SingleID = int.Parse(Request["ID"].ToString()); string connStr = ConfigurationManager.ConnectionStrings["ConnectionString"].ConnectionString; using (SqlConnection conn = new SqlConnection(connStr)) { SqlCommand cmd = conn.CreateCommand(); cmd.CommandText = "Select * from JudgeProblem where ID=" + SingleID; conn.Open(); SqlDataReader DR = cmd.ExecuteReader(); if (DR.Read()) { bool i = (bool)DR["Answer"]; txtTitle.Text = DR["Title"].ToString(); if (i == true) { rblAnswer.SelectedIndex = 0; } else { rblAnswer.SelectedIndex = 1; } } DR.Close(); conn.Close(); } } } }
protected void Page_Load(object sender, EventArgs e) { this.Page.Title = "增加试题"; if (!IsPostBack) { if (Session["userID"] == null) { Response.Redirect("Login.aspx"); } else { ddlCourse.Items.Clear(); Course course = new Course(); List <Course> list = SingleSelectedService.ListCourse(); for (int i = 0; i < list.Count; i++) { ListItem item = new ListItem(list[i].DepartmentName.ToString(), list[i].DepartmentId.ToString()); ddlCourse.Items.Add(item); } } } }
protected void Button1_Click(object sender, EventArgs e) { string UserID = Session["userID"].ToString(); string PaperID = ddlPaper.SelectedValue; if (!(SingleSelectedService.Getitem(UserID, PaperID))) { lblMessage.Text = "您已经考过"; } else { Session["PaperID"] = ddlPaper.SelectedValue; Session["PaperName"] = ddlPaper.SelectedItem.Text; Session["userID"] = Session["userID"].ToString(); Session["userName"] = labUser.Text; // Response.Write("<script>window.open('UserTest.aspx?paperId=" + ddlPaper.SelectedValue + "',null,'fullscreen=1')</script>"); //Page.ClientScript.RegisterStartupScript(Page.ClientScript.GetType(), "myscript", "<script>windows.onload=function(){aa();}</script>"); Response.Redirect("ExampaperMaster.aspx?paperId=" + ddlPaper.SelectedValue + ""); this.Page.ClientScript.RegisterStartupScript(this.Page.GetType(), "", "<script>aa();</script>"); Response.Write("<script language=javascript>window.close('StudentIndex2.aspx');</script>"); } }
protected void Page_Load(object sender, EventArgs e) { this.Page.Title = "修改试题"; if (!IsPostBack) { if (Session["userID"] == null) { Response.Redirect("Login.aspx"); } else { string userId = Session["userID"].ToString(); string userName = UserManager.GetUserName(userId); Label i1 = (Label)Page.Master.FindControl("labUser"); i1.Text = userName; //展示绑定的数据并将它展示在下拉列表中 ddlCourse.Items.Clear(); Course course = new Course(); List <Course> list = SingleSelectedService.ListCourse(); for (int i = 0; i < list.Count; i++) { ListItem item = new ListItem(list[i].DepartmentName.ToString(), list[i].DepartmentId.ToString()); ddlCourse.Items.Add(item); } //根据ID展示相应的值 int SingleID = int.Parse(Request["ID"].ToString()); string connStr = ConfigurationManager.ConnectionStrings["ConnectionString"].ConnectionString; using (SqlConnection conn = new SqlConnection(connStr)) { SqlCommand cmd = conn.CreateCommand(); cmd.CommandText = "Select * from MultiProblem where ID=" + SingleID; conn.Open(); SqlDataReader DR = cmd.ExecuteReader(); if (DR.Read()) { ddlCourse.SelectedValue = DR["CourseID"].ToString(); txtTitle.Text = DR["Title"].ToString(); txtAnswerA.Text = DR["AnswerA"].ToString(); txtAnswerB.Text = DR["AnswerB"].ToString(); txtAnswerC.Text = DR["AnswerC"].ToString(); txtAnswerD.Text = DR["AnswerD"].ToString(); txtAnswerE.Text = DR["AnswerE"].ToString(); txtAnswerF.Text = DR["AnswerF"].ToString(); //把从数据库中查到的值在界面上相应的钩选上 string answer = DR["Answer"].ToString(); foreach (ListItem item in cblAnswer.Items) { foreach (char c in answer) { if (item.Value == c.ToString()) { item.Selected = true; } } } } DR.Close(); conn.Close(); } } } }